The Asthma Score in 35130, Quinton, Alabama is 23 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

86.63 percent of the population in 35130 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 30.76 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 10.60 percent of the residents in 35130 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.82 members with about 2.07 cars available per household.

An estimate of 89.43 percent of the residents in 35130 has some form of health insurance. 49.79 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 54.17 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 35130 would have to travel an average of 46.41 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, St Vincent's St Clair .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 35130, Quinton, Alabama.

As of , an estimate of 3,509 residents live in 35130 with a median age of 47.1 years. 23.91 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 28.10 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 31.68 percent of the residents in 35130 is currently married, and 23.22 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 35130 is $5,332.83.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 35130 is approximately $416. The median household spends about 7.80 percent of their income on housing.
